区块链溯源平台的用户权限管理是怎样设计的?
区块链溯源平台的用户权限管理是一个复杂且重要的组成部分,涉及到多个角色和权限的设计。为了确保信息的安全性与可控性,用户权限管理的设计应涵盖多个方面。在用户角色的定义上,通常会设定不同的角色以适应平台的需求。常见的角色包括管理员、生产者、消费者及审核员。管理员负责整体平台的管理与维护,包括用户的注册、角色分配以及数据的权限设置。生产者则通常负责提交与更新产品信息,他们的权限设计需要确保其能够上传和修改与自己相关的数据。消费者的权限相对较低,主要集中在查看信息上,而审核员则需在一定权限范围内审核生产者提交的数据。在权限分配上,应考虑角色的功能与职责。用户的权限应细化到操作级别,例如创建、读取、更新及删除(CRUD)操作。允许某些角色进行数据的创建与更新,而其他角色仅具备读取的权限。通过这样精细化的权限设置,能够有效防止未经授权的数据更改及泄露。权限管理还需要考虑基于任务和时间的灵活性。根据业务需求,某些操作可能仅需在特定时间内完成,这就要求系统能够动态调整用户的权限。例如,在某个重要的审计周期内,特定角色可能需要获得更高的查询权限。区块链的特性使得所有的操作都可以被记录和追踪。因此,用户的权限管理系统应结合区块链技术,采用"https://www.chainsafeai.com/" title="智能合约">智能合约来强化权限管理。例如,"https://www.chainsafeai.com/" title="智能合约">智能合约可以用于自动检查用户权限,并控制他们对特定数据的访问。这种机制确保了权限的不可篡改性,并增加了透明度,用户在进行任何操作时,都能明确知道自己所拥有的权限与责任。安全性是用户权限管理不可或缺的一部分。建立两步验证机制以及相关的安全认证方式,可以有效地保证账户的安全。一些高权限用户的访问,可以通过多因素认证来保障。这不仅防止了潜在的账户被盗风险,也增加了数据安全的保障。与用户权限管理相结合的是审计机制,这对于监控用户行为以及权限使用情况至关重要。通过记录用户的每一次操作,包括谁在何时进行了什么操作,可以为后续的操作提供追踪依据。这一过程不仅有助于内部管理,也为合规和审计提供了捷径。除了上述的基本设计,用户权限管理系统应具备良好的可扩展性。随着业务的增长,可能会有新的用户角色被引入,或者现有角色的权限需要调整。因此,设计一个灵活可调的权限管理模块,将有助于快速响应市场的变化及需求的增加。在实施过程中,培训用户了解权限设置的重要性也是不可忽视的环节。通过定期培训,确保所有用户都理解自身的权限及责任,从而提高平台的运作效率和安全层级。通过明确的指导与监管,可以进一步降低因误操作导致的风险。区块链溯源平台的用户权限管理设计是一个多层面、多维度的复杂体系,了解到每个角色的需求与责任,并建立适合的权限体系,将大大增强平台的安全性和可靠性。通过"https://www.chainsafeai.com/" title="智能合约">智能合约实现权限的自动管控与审计机制的结合,使得整个系统更加高效与透明。
ChainSafeAI(链熵科技)专注于区块链生态安全,以“数据驱动 + 技术赋能”构建360°全方位安全防护体系,服务于交易所、金融机构、OTC服务商及加密资产投资者。公司提供覆盖KYT风险监测、智能"https://www.chainsafeai.com/" title="合约审计">合约审计、加密资产追踪、区块链漏洞测试等在内的全维度安全与合规技术解决方案,助力客户防范洗钱、诈骗等风险,保障业务合规运行。通过实时风险预警、合规审查与资金溯源分析,协助客户识别链上异常行为、防范洗钱及诈骗风险、降低被盗损失并提升资产追回可能性。